The Evolution of Network Operations Centers
Today’s sophisticated command centers bear little resemblance to their humble 1960s predecessors. The journey from basic monitoring stations to intelligent hubs reflects decades of technological advancement and growing business demands.
Historical Insights and Modern Shifts
We trace this evolution back to AT&T’s pioneering work in the 1960s. They established the first centralized monitoring system for telephone infrastructure. This foundation established principles that still guide modern practices.
Traditional centers functioned as reactive stations where technicians responded to issues after they occurred. They had limited visibility into emerging problems and minimal predictive capabilities.
From Traditional IT to AI-driven Solutions
Modern network operations centers have transformed into intelligent command hubs. They integrate artificial intelligence and machine learning algorithms to shift from reactive response to proactive prevention.
This evolution addresses unprecedented monitoring challenges. By 2024, Ericsson predicts 4.1 billion cellular IoT connections worldwide. Such scale demands advanced automation that exceeds human capacity.
AI-driven solutions analyze massive data volumes in real-time. They identify patterns indicating potential problems and automatically implement remediation actions. This prevents issues from impacting business operations.

Deep Dive into IT Network Operations
Sophisticated network operations centers deliver value through a structured framework of specialized responsibilities and tiered expertise. These centers oversee complex digital environments spanning servers, databases, firewalls, and cloud services to maintain continuous business operations.
Key Functions and Responsibilities
We implement a tiered approach to incident management that ensures appropriate expertise addresses each issue efficiently. This structured methodology categorizes problems by severity level, from routine alerts to critical system failures.
| Incident Level | Description | Response Focus |
|---|---|---|
| Level 1 | Routine infrastructure alerts and minor performance issues | Automated assessment and basic troubleshooting |
| Level 2 | Moderate service disruptions requiring technical expertise | Advanced troubleshooting and coordination |
| Level 3 | Critical incidents like ransomware attacks or complete outages | Emergency response and disaster recovery activation |
Our comprehensive management includes software updates, troubleshooting, and installation across all connected systems. We maintain robust data backup procedures and ensure accessibility during normal operations and recovery scenarios.
Continuous monitoring analyzes system health while generating performance reports that identify optimization opportunities. This proactive approach enhances reliability and user experience across all connected resources.
We distinguish our network operations center from security operations centers by focusing on availability and performance continuity. While SOCs specialize in threat detection, our centers ensure operational stability through systematic maintenance and control.

Best Practices for Network Management and Monitoring
Establishing effective operational frameworks requires more than just advanced technology—it demands disciplined human processes. We build resilient systems through comprehensive training programs and clearly defined protocols that ensure consistent service delivery.
Our approach begins with continuous knowledge development for technical staff. They maintain expertise in monitoring technologies and resolution techniques specific to evolving infrastructure requirements.
Training, Escalation Protocols, and SOPs
We implement robust training covering all potential scenarios. This ensures personnel remain current with changing technology landscapes and emerging threats.
Clear role definition balances empowered decision-making with necessary oversight. Each technician understands their authority levels and reporting lines for efficient incident management.
Well-documented escalation protocols specify when issues move to experienced personnel. This prevents delays that could extend downtime or increase business impact.
| Escalation Level | Trigger Criteria | Response Time | Required Expertise |
|---|---|---|---|
| Level 1 | Minor performance degradation | Within 30 minutes | Junior technicians |
| Level 2 | Multiple user affected | Within 15 minutes | Senior specialists |
| Level 3 | Critical service outage | Immediate | Team leads and architects |
Strong communication frameworks facilitate coordination between teams. This creates transparency enabling rapid problem-solving and preventing information silos.
Comprehensive standard operating procedures document approaches to common issues. They ensure consistent service delivery and reduce response quality variance.
We leverage established frameworks like ITIL and ISO standards to structure management practices. These proven methodologies enhance operational maturity and support continuous improvement.

Real-Life Case Studies and Success Stories
Brazilian telecommunications provider Nextel exemplifies the transformative potential of cognitive technology in modern infrastructure management. With over 4 million subscribers demanding continuous connectivity, the company faced significant challenges maintaining service quality across complex environments.
Insights from Telecom and Financial Services
Nextel’s previous approach to incident response averaged 30 minutes per network issue, creating customer dissatisfaction in a competitive market. The organization implemented IBM Netcool Operations Insight to monitor 25,000 network elements, incorporating Watson cognitive technology for predictive analysis.
This strategic shift delivered dramatic improvements in network performance and operational efficiency. Nextel achieved an 83% reduction in response time, cutting incident resolution from 30 minutes to just five minutes.
